Basicly the story is that there is a guy that well..''eats people's sins''...
he forgives what God wont forgive..and basicly he eats bread and salt off sinners chest, he eats their sin, and they die....
Well...it was a good idea, it just went all wrong...
Sin Eater cannot die, unless he is killed by a 'special' dagger, and who kills sin eater, he basicly gets his job....ahh...its all dodgy!
I think its very different to all other films, cos it doesnt define good-evil...there isnt a clear thing..
Sin Eater is good and Bad...depends which way you look at it....

BackFire349
the fact that it makes you use your head in order to finish seeing the horrific acts that are only started on screen. the way leatherface is introduced to us, out of no where, and exits just as quickly, leaving us wondering what has just happeend, who is he, whats his story? the fact that is relies on realism to push its dark atmosphere, rather then just blood and guts spilling all over, it goes out of its way to make us use our minds. thats what makes TCM so great, it combines all the sub-genres of horror, it is part exploitation, part psychological, and part slasher.
